Subject: Handover — FieldMap offline mode

Taking over FieldMap DBA duties from me as of Friday. Offline mode syncs survey batches to the staging replica every 20 minutes; conflicts land in sync_quarantine. If surveyors report missing plots, check that table first, then replay via the admin console. The sync worker authenticates with the connection string below.

replica DSN, kajep-yahag: mssql://praok_svc:iF@db-8d68.plorvaio.local:5432/eliion

Hey Mara — quick recap of last night's cut-over for the Thornbury edge tier. We moved health checks off the old ping endpoint and onto the new readiness probe behind the Quillgate balancer. Traffic drained cleanly, no flapping, and the two laggard nodes were just slow cert reloads. Since you'll be poking at this next week, the main thing to know is the probe settings. The balancer now runs with the following configuration.

deployment values, yadug-bawif:
[framir]
team = pelox
access_code = ac_a38ab2
owner = tamion.julael
host = framir.tolvaqlabs.test
port = 11211
peer = tammir.zemvargrid.local
salt = 2215ef03
pin = 1541

## Deployment

The tile prefetcher (we call it Hoardling) runs as a single worker per region and warms the cache ahead of predicted demand. Deploys are dead simple: push to main, CI builds the image, and the scheduler rolls it out region by region. One gotcha — don't deploy during the morning prefetch window or you'll dump half-warmed tiles and the cache hit rate tanks for an hour. Zoom ranges, concurrency, and the upstream tile source are all driven by the values below.

deployment values, fahap-hahaf:
[casdor]
port = 9200
region = south-2
host = casdor.qirvanworks.corp
timeout_ms = 3000
retries = 4

Subject: Quickstore 4.2 — bloom filter now fronts the KV layer

Plugin authors: starting with this release, Quickstore places a bloom filter ahead of the key-value store. Negative lookups return faster; false positives fall through safely. No API changes are required on your side. Verify your plugin against the staging build referenced below.

session token of fahif-tadup = htk3_9c7